My 02 did the same thing two years ago. I thought for sure it was switch related. Local dealer said it was the starter solenoid. Ordered the part, but they screwed up and ordered the starter relay instead ($11). I bought the relay and bumped into the mechanic on the way out. Told him about the wrong part, he said I wasted $11. I said oh well, call me when the solenoid comes in ($100). They never called back, and after two weeks I decided what the heck, put the relay in. With the new relay, I've never had a problem since. (still waiting for the call on that starter solenoid....) You might want to take the $11 gamble, not much to lose. Keep us posted. This problem frustrated me for several months before swapping out the relay.
